Output 59c89493c19e3763f06ef5b302aae6c38577114bddacb9fb1993d847d1f1c172:45

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1e7e3903d99d97141e12e0a2fb4ca5b325e7a947b07bc579ab4b7cae0b7e32ea
address
bc1prelrjq7enkt3g8sjuz30kn99kvj70228kpau27dtfd72uzm7xt4q588hcs
transaction
59c89493c19e3763f06ef5b302aae6c38577114bddacb9fb1993d847d1f1c172
spent
true